Why remote and exterior labor forces need a various first aid mindset

If you run a city office, the majority of clinical emergency situations get a professional rescue feedback within minutes. For a group working in remote or tough surface, the moment from injury to innovative care might be an hour or even more. Those added minutes transform everything.

In remote and outside settings, you often encounter a mix of factors. There may be limited communications, long cot lugs, bad weather condition, and improvisated devices. Threats are additionally different. Quad rollovers in agriculture, chainsaw injuries in forestry, falls from height in building and construction, and chilly water immersion in coastal job all turn up more often than city cardiovascular disease at the printer.

In my experience, 3 shifts in believing make the largest difference for remote teams.

First, the standard first aid course content have to be adapted to the real field dangers. Rural and exterior employees need even more environmental emergency training, even more circumstance experiment minimal gear, and even more focus on improvisation.

Second, employees have to expect to supply care for longer. That suggests stronger standard life support abilities, not just a quick summary of CPR and defibrillation. Look after bleeding, breathing, and shock can quickly stretch to 30 to 60 mins prior to rescue arrives.

Third, training needs to be regular adequate and sensible enough that people do not freeze or forget. This is where express first aid courses and fast first aid training verify beneficial. Short, focused sessions provided more frequently have a tendency to stick much better than a large block of material delivered once every few years.

What "express" actually suggests in first aid and CPR training

The term express first aid course obtains used loosely. Occasionally it means a solid, compressed program that values time without reducing corners. Various other times, it is little more than a hurried lecture for a certificate on paper. The difference remains in how the course is structured and what is called for previously and after the class session.

A well developed express first aid or express cpr course usually does 3 things.

It relocations background concept to self paced learning. Students full online modules prior to they arrive. They cover lawful duties, basic anatomy, and vital principles at their own speed. This indicates the in person time can focus on practical work.

It narrows the focus to the skills most relevant to the workers. For remote and outside teams, that means heavy focus on handling bleeding, fractures, spinal problems, hypothermia, heat disease, asthma, anaphylaxis, and CPR. Less time is spent on reduced threat, reduced effect conditions.

It needs analysis that demonstrates competence, not just participation. A fast first aid course can legally award a first aid certificate if participants show, under some stress, that they can perform essential abilities to standard. Short does not need to indicate superficial.

By comparison, beware of fast first aid courses or fast cpr courses that guarantee certification with virtually no practical evaluation, or no possibility to exercise abilities on manikins, or no circumstances that show your workplace. Fast certification is attractive, yet if the training does not hold up under anxiety, it can produce incorrect confidence.

The core abilities that can not be compromised

Express first aid courses live or die by what they maintain, not what they reduced. For remote and outside workers, particular skills are non negotiable, also in fast first aid courses or fast cpr refresher courses.

At a minimum, any kind of express first aid training for these environments should leave people skilled in the adhering to collection of skills.

They needs to be able to run a quick scene study and primary evaluation. That includes danger sign in dynamic environments, calling for aid early, and prioritising life dangers prior to secondary injuries.

They needs to be comfortable with first aid and cpr as a consolidated reaction. That means effective chest compressions, rescue breaths first aid certificate Cannon Hill where proper, safe use of an AED, and rotation between rescuers to decrease exhaustion during extended CPR. Numerous express cpr courses aim at city events where ambulance reaction fasts. For remote workers, express cpr training must expect longer efforts.

They should take care of significant blood loss with straight stress, stress dressings, and, where ideal and legal, tourniquets and haemostatic dressings. Forestry and construction sites specifically see injuries where blood loss is the critical factor.

They should secure presumed spinal injuries on uneven ground with extremely limited gear. In an actual occurrence, you hardly ever have a full paramedic package. A fast first aid course that trains people to improvise with jackets, ropes, and backpacks is better than one that just educates textbook techniques.

They needs to acknowledge environmental hazards promptly. Hypothermia, hyperthermia, heat stroke, dehydration, and lightning risk behave very differently in remote surface than they carry out in town. Outdoor workers need more than a passing slide on these topics.

Once these structures remain in place, express first aid courses can layer in allergies, asthma, diabetic issues, seizures, minor wound care, and other frequent problems. For some teams, especially those taking care of youngsters in outside education or country childcare, express childcare first aid courses also need modules on choking, febrile convulsions, and paediatric CPR ratios.

Express childcare first aid for outdoor settings

Many child care employees and educators are now leading youngsters right into woodlands, ranch visits, exterior education and learning camps, and nature play programs. The threats are different to a classroom. Kids wander, climb, react highly to insect stings, and become hypothermic or dehydrated faster than adults.

An express childcare first aid course that mirrors a conventional class program misses that truth. Express childcare first aid training for outside setups need to cover three additional dimensions.

First, paediatric first aid and cpr technique should account for actual surface. Rescuers usually try child CPR on picnic tables, damp ground, or confined car seats. Training needs to give personnel time to attempt CPR on child and baby manikins in these awkward positions, not just on a level clean floor.

Second, an express child care first aid program needs a more powerful focus on allergy and bronchial asthma administration in the area. That implies useful drills with adrenaline auto injectors, spacer devices, and inhalers, and reasonable situations where one adult handles several troubled kids at once.

Third, the course should speak about team management under tension. In every genuine event I have reviewed that engaged children outdoors, there went to the very least someone doing first aid and someone shepherding or reassuring the rest of the group. Training that presumes a solitary child and a solitary adult disregards how childcare in fact works.

Making express courses benefit remote rosters

A huge advantage of express first aid courses is scheduling adaptability. Remote and outside job frequently works on rosters, change patterns, and seasonal peaks that do not match a common service week. A typical two day first aid course can wipe out a critical job window, particularly at harvest, lambing, damp season preparation, or mid project.

I have seen three models function particularly well.

Some employers run short express first aid and cpr courses at shift transition points. Crews coming off a rotation stay on an added half day to complete functional training, after ending up online content while on site during reduced danger periods.

Others divided fast first aid training right into components throughout a number of weeks. Workers finish a 2 or three hour express cpr course first, then a separate half day focused on injury administration, then a last session for environmental and clinical problems. This fits around transforming climate and area conditions.

A 3rd method uses a combined version where a nucleus obtains advanced fap first aid training, while the larger labor force completes shorter express first aid and fast cpr refresher course sessions. The core group serves as lead responders, yet everyone has sufficient skill to act if they are initially on scene.

However you design it, the trick is predictability. Remote employees are used to lengthy drives, exhaustion, and shifting strategies. If express first aid courses are scheduled carelessly, presence and retention suffer. A foreseeable rotation, such as a fast first aid course every year and a brief express cpr refresher at the 6 month mark, maintains abilities alive without frustrating the roster.

Balancing speed, high quality, and lawful requirements

One of the most common inquiries I hear from managers is whether a fast first aid course or express cpr training will satisfy regulators. The sincere solution is that it depends on your territory, your industry, and the structure of the course.

Most regulators focus much less on how much time the course runs and much more on whether the needed topics are covered to a defined standard. That is where blended knowing can be found in. If a first aid and cpr course requires, as an example, 8 hours of total instruction, a supplier could legitimately provide 4 hours of on the internet components and a 4 hour express first aid functional, as opposed to a full day in a classroom.

Problems emerge when fast certification is provided without that deepness. A 2 hour class with no pre knowing, no evaluation, and minimal method might not meet legal limits for first aid training, even if the certificate claims otherwise. As the company, you carry duty for choosing courses that fulfill standards.

There is additionally a threat of over dealing with. Some safety and security supervisors, burned by weak short courses, firmly insist that every worker attend long, generic programs that cover a broad range of reduced importance content. The result is commonly poor engagement. Workers entrust a certificate yet vague recall of essential skills.

A reliable balance for remote and outdoor groups resembles this. The majority of team total concentrated, fast first aid courses that directly attend to top risks and construct strong fundamental life assistance abilities. A smaller sized staff full more advanced first aid training, with longer face to face time and scenario based evaluation. Together, they create a split feedback system on site.

A short situation instance from field practice

Several years back, I worked with a renewable resource business developing wind turbines in a remote, windy passage. The nearby ambulance base was approximately 90 minutes away on good roadways. Early in the job, the company sent each crew to a basic urban first aid course. The course covered office injuries broadly, but there was nearly no technique in harnesses, poor climate, or on unequal ground. When we ran a joint exercise with regional emergency situation solutions, the gaps were obvious.

After that exercise, the business redesigned its strategy. They engaged a service provider experienced in outdoor and industrial rescue to provide express first aid courses on website. Employees completed on-line components throughout downtime in camp, then participated in a four hour practical that occurred on real generator systems, gravel gain access to roads, and in vehicles. Fast cpr training utilized the very same AED versions set up across the site. Situations involved wind, sound, and the unpleasant angles they would encounter if a person collapsed at height.

They likewise presented short fast cpr refresher course sessions at the beginning of month-to-month security conferences. These 20 min refreshers concentrated only on compressions, AED use, and group interaction. Within a year, when a service provider suffered a significant heart occasion in a staging area, the action was fast, coordinated, and positive. CPR was started within a min, the AED was applied in roughly 3 minutes, and handover to paramedics accompanied a clear verbal record that showed their training.

No training program guarantees an end result, yet the distinction between their first exercise which genuine occurrence was stark. The useful, customized, express first aid training plainly paid off.
